Hazy light tan. Aroma is older, stale hops and chewy malts. But the cacao really shows up on the palate. It’s balanced with some nice chocolate sweetness and rich, chewy earthy bitterness. Ends up being a pretty nice beer, despite the uninspiring aroma.

Orange color, hazed, thick white head, nice lacing. Caramel malts with candy sugar on top with heavy bitter hops and a leftover of burnt cocoa. Average carbonation full heavy body creamy texture. Bitter finish. Interesting.

Pours dark blonde, with a good white head. Smell is that f white chocolate- buttery and all - plus some bitterness. taste is likewise. Storng cacao taste, in between milkchocolate and white chocolate ( white, building up to milk ) , over a medium-bitter backbone. Certainly interesting ! If this beer were regularly optainable for me, I don’t think I would drink it often though, and I can clearly see how people can strongly dislike this. But for now and than, this unique ( to me ) combo might just be the thing you’re after. And personally, I like it ! The only thing I kinda dislike is the weird sweetness.. Is it the cacao?
